Linux Mysql 卸载/局域网访问权限
2012-06-12 09:13
316 查看
一、
修改MYSQL配置文件:
sudo
vi /etc/mysql/my.cnf
注释掉:bind-address
= 127.0.0.1
二、添加
Mysql 管理帐号:
1、mysql
-uroot -p (先登录MYSQL)
2、添加MYSQL帐户
规则:GRANT
ALL ON db.table(或*.*) TO username@192.168.1.% IDENTIFIED BY “password”
示例(添加用户lozv,允许访问所有表,允许在局域网段访问):
GRANT
ALL PRIVILEGES ON *.* TO ‘lozv’@’192.168.1.%’ IDENTIFIED BY ‘http://lozv.com’;
三、重新启动MYSQL服务:
sudo
service mysql restart
sudo
/etc/init.d/mysql restart
(不同系统,请自行寻找启动方法)
PS:局域网访问MYSQL有可能会比较慢,你可能需要MYSQL优化,方法如下:
sudo
vi /etc/mysql/my.cnf
[mysqld]下面加入如下两行:
skip-name-resolve
skip-grant-tables
重新启动MYSQL
删除
mysql
sudo
apt-get autoremove --purge mysql-server-5.0
sudo
apt-get remove mysql-server
sudo
apt-get autoremove mysql-server
sudo
apt-get remove mysql-common //这个很重要
上面的其实有一些是多余的。
清理残留数据
修改MYSQL配置文件:
sudo
vi /etc/mysql/my.cnf
注释掉:bind-address
= 127.0.0.1
二、添加
Mysql 管理帐号:
1、mysql
-uroot -p (先登录MYSQL)
2、添加MYSQL帐户
规则:GRANT
ALL ON db.table(或*.*) TO username@192.168.1.% IDENTIFIED BY “password”
示例(添加用户lozv,允许访问所有表,允许在局域网段访问):
GRANT
ALL PRIVILEGES ON *.* TO ‘lozv’@’192.168.1.%’ IDENTIFIED BY ‘http://lozv.com’;
三、重新启动MYSQL服务:
sudo
service mysql restart
sudo
/etc/init.d/mysql restart
(不同系统,请自行寻找启动方法)
PS:局域网访问MYSQL有可能会比较慢,你可能需要MYSQL优化,方法如下:
sudo
vi /etc/mysql/my.cnf
[mysqld]下面加入如下两行:
skip-name-resolve
skip-grant-tables
重新启动MYSQL
删除
mysql
sudo
apt-get autoremove --purge mysql-server-5.0
sudo
apt-get remove mysql-server
sudo
apt-get autoremove mysql-server
sudo
apt-get remove mysql-common //这个很重要
上面的其实有一些是多余的。
清理残留数据
dpkg -l |grep ^rc|awk '{print $2}' |sudo xargs dpkg -P
相关文章推荐
- linux mysql远程访问不了/mysql远程访问权限
- linux下mysql开启远程访问权限及防火墙开放3306端口
- Linux下MySQL开放root的远程访问权限
- Linux下MySQL开放root的远程访问权限
- linux下mysql开启远程访问权限及防火墙开放3306端口
- 解决mysql的问题安装卸载以及配置外部访问权限的各种问题总结
- 在Ubuntu/Linux环境下使用MySQL:开放/修改3306端口、开放访问权限
- linux下mysql开启远程访问权限及防火墙开放3306端口
- Linux下访问MySQL的数据库权限不够的问题
- 在Linux(CentOS 6.2 64位操作系统)下安装MySQL数据并开启远程访问权限
- linux下mysql开启远程访问权限及防火墙开放3306端口
- linux_ubuntu12.04 卸载和安装mysql、远程访问、not allowed
- linux下mysql开启远程访问权限及防火墙开放3306端口
- linux下mysql开启远程访问权限及防火墙开放3306端口
- linux下mysql开启远程访问权限 防火墙开放3306端口
- linux下yum安装mysql并设置访问权限
- linux局域网访问MYSQL慢的问题
- linux安装mysql之设置远程访问权限
- linux下mysql开启远程访问权限及防火墙开放3306端口
- 在Ubuntu/Linux环境下使用MySQL:开放/修改3306端口、开放访问权限